Autoimmune Disease
A condition in which the body's immune system mistakenly attacks its own cells, leading to various health issues.
Insulin Deficiency
A lack of the hormone insulin in the body, which is crucial for regulating blood glucose levels.
Type 1 Diabetes
A chronic condition where the pancreas produces little or no insulin, necessitating insulin administration for management.
Thyrotropin
Another term for th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H), a hormone secreted by the pituitary gland to regulate the production of thyroid hormones.
